Dhaka, May 13 -- The Bangladesh Railway authorities will begin selling advance train tickets online from May 21 ahead of Eid-ul-Azha.

With June 7 tentatively set as the date for the second-largest religious festival for Muslims, holidaymakers can purchase tickets for travel from May 31 to June 6 between May 21 and May 27 under a special arrangement.

Tickets for May 31 will be sold on May 21; tickets for June 1 will be sold on May 22; tickets for June 2 will be sold on May 23; tickets for June 3 will be sold on May 24; tickets for June 4 will be sold on May 25; tickets for June 5 will be sold on May 26; and tickets for June 6 will be sold on May 27.
